Reading Time: 5 minutesWhat Sparklers Are Safe for Kids? Sparkles fireworks are a staple of July 4th celebrations, but not every sparkler is appropriate for every age. Sparklers burn at temperatures between 1,200°F and 1,800°F depending on composition, which is hot enough to ignite clothing and cause third-degree burns on contact. The key variables that determine child safety are wire type, length, burn time, and chemical composition. Reading Time: 4 minutesMold disputes between landlords and tenants are common in Los Angeles. When mold appears in a rental unit, the question of who is legally responsible often becomes contentious. California law places clear obligations on property owners to maintain habitable living conditions. Mold inspections in LA play a central role in documenting whether a landlord has met those obligations or ignored a known hazard.
